Breaking Down the Evaluation Pillars for Meme Devs

BNB Chain judges projects on design, tech quality, ecosystem fit, innovation, and sustainability. Here's how to apply this to your meme token ventures:

Design & Usability: Make It Meme-Worthy and User-Friendly

Users should love interacting with your project as much as they love sharing memes. Document your user journey clearly—use flow diagrams in your repo to show how someone mints a token or joins a community vote. For meme tokens, this could mean a seamless wallet integration for tipping memes or a fun UI for staking.

A strong example? A clean architecture diagram explaining how your token's smart contract handles viral giveaways without gas wars.

Technical Implementation & Code Quality: Keep It Clean and Open

Your code is your project's backbone. Make your GitHub repo public, organized, and documented—think folders for contracts, frontend, and docs. Use open-source licenses like MIT to encourage forks and community contributions, which is perfect for meme culture where remixes rule.

For deployability, include a Docker setup so anyone can spin up your meme marketplace. Avoid hardcoded secrets; use .env files. This transparency builds trust, essential for meme tokens prone to rug-pull suspicions.

BNB Chain Integration & Ecosystem Fit: Leverage the Tools

This is where BNB shines for memes. Deploy your smart contracts on BSC and verify them on BscScan. Integrate with opBNB for layer-2 scaling to handle viral spikes cheaply, Greenfield for storing meme images on-chain, or BEP standards for your token.

Imagine a meme token that uses Greenfield to store user-generated art, making it truly decentralized and resistant to censorship. Show how your project adds value—like boosting liquidity on BNB DEXs or integrating with other ecosystem dApps.

Innovation & Creativity: Stand Out in the Meme Crowd

Memes are all about novelty, so highlight what makes yours unique. Frame a clear problem, like "centralized meme platforms limit creativity," and solve it with blockchain. Use emerging tech like AI for auto-generating memes based on token holders' inputs.

Judges love first-of-a-kind ideas, so if your token incorporates modular design for upgradable memes or L2 for instant trades, that's a win.

Sustainability & Market Potential: Beyond the Hype

Meme tokens often lack longevity, but BNB wants projects with plans. Define your target audience—crypto degens, artists, or gamers—and outline tokenomics for revenue, like fees funding community bounties.

Craft a roadmap: Launch on BSC, integrate opBNB for scaling, partner with meme influencers. This shows judges your meme isn't just a fad but a potential ecosystem staple.
